## Ticket: Config drift on Farewell pricing experiment

The Torvane ticket-pricing experiment is running with different parameters in staging versus production, which makes A/B results unreliable. Someone hand-edited production last sprint and never backported the change. New folks: our configs live in the `pricing-conf` repo and should only change via PR. For context, production currently reports the following values.

config for kafof-bawef:
holath:
  log_level: debug
  metrics_host: metrics.holath.qorvelsys.internal
  pin: 2191
  pool_size: 32

## Service Accounts for Nightfill Plugins

Plugins that schedule nightly backfills through Nightfill run under a dedicated service account, not your personal login. The account grants enqueue and status-read permissions only; it cannot cancel jobs owned by other plugins. Each account is issued one API key, rotated quarterly. Requests without it are rejected before scheduling. Your plugin's current key appears below.

gateway credential: kto23_LX9A4ys6i4nzHtpOLNLodKK

## Support

BigDelta is our diff viewer for files that make normal diff tools cry — it streams comparisons instead of loading everything into memory. If a release build chokes on a file over 2GB, grab the worker logs and file a ticket. For anything blocking a release cut, email the maintainers directly here.

escalation mailbox, bafog-fafog: ulador@paliqlabs.internal

## Artifact Signing — ReceiptRelay

ReceiptRelay is the mailer that sends donation receipts for the Hartleaf giving platform. Every release artifact must be signed before the Bramwell deploy pipeline will accept it. The signing step runs in `relay-release.yml` and verifies the tarball digest against the manifest. Rotate the key quarterly and record the rotation in this page's history. Never sign artifacts built outside the pipeline. For reference, maintainers currently sign releases with the following key:

deploy key for tadug-tafog: bky3_hqi